RONNIE Bailey betrayed his own brother Ed in a scheme he came up with alongside Debbie Webster. <\/p>\n

But things take a turn when Ed's gambling addiction seems to make a return next week in Coronation Street. <\/p>\n

Vinta Morgan's ITV alter ego began his secretive move against Ed Bailey (portrayed by Trevor Michael Georges) after his on-screen nephew Michael was embroiled in an altercation between newcomer Cassie Plummer and drug dealer Dean Turnbull. <\/p>\n

Ronnie was on the scene in hospital when Michael (Ryan Russell) was struck by Dean and he urged him to call the police. <\/p>\n

However, a terrorised Cassie (Claire Sweeney) managed to convinced them to keep the authorities out of the situation. <\/p>\n

But when Michael admitted this was a frequent occurrence for his nurse mother Aggie Bailey (Lorna Laidlaw), Ronnie decided to use it all to his advantage. <\/p>\n

In a shocking financial scheme, Ronnie convinced his brother Ed to invest under the guise of using profits to help Aggie retire earlier. <\/p>\n

As Ed's nerves seemed to get the best of him, Ronnie reassured him before being seen heading off to the Rovers and filling Debbie Webster (Sue Devaney) in on all the details. <\/p>\n

Regular viewers of the Manchester-based drama will remember that Debbie convinced Ronnie he could invest in shares in Newton and Ridley to make more cash. <\/p>\n

The insider dealing left Ed sceptical as it's also a criminal offence but, as mentioned above, Ronnie made sure he was in by hiding the finer details of the deal from him. <\/p>\n

But in a devastating twist, it appears that Ed is struggling once again with his gambling addiction. <\/p>\n

Coming up on ITV next week, when Ed\u2019s late for a celebratory meal at Speed Daal with Ronnie and Debbie, it's implied that his gambling demons have come back to haunt him. <\/p>\n
